How they compare

Nicaragua currently reports 0.9869 GPIA against 0.9752 GPIA in UNICEF: Eastern and Southern Africa, a difference of 0.0117 GPIA.

Across all 28 years both countries report, Nicaragua has been ahead every year.

Nicaragua ranks 149th and UNICEF: Eastern and Southern Africa ranks 149th of 208 countries.

Nicaragua has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Nicaragua UNICEF: Eastern and Southern Africa Difference Ahead
1970s 1.02 GPIA 0.8222 GPIA 0.1971 GPIA Nicaragua
1980s 1.13 GPIA 0.8675 GPIA 0.265 GPIA Nicaragua
1990s 1.04 GPIA 0.8709 GPIA 0.1671 GPIA Nicaragua
2000s 1.01 GPIA 0.8929 GPIA 0.1184 GPIA Nicaragua
2010s 1 GPIA 0.9277 GPIA 0.0736 GPIA Nicaragua
2020s 0.9884 GPIA 0.9752 GPIA 0.0132 GPIA Nicaragua

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
